During the Windows 8 Update

"Installing Windows will affect these devices or applications."

The compatibility report that recommends you close Windows Setup and uninstall the necessary applications (drivers). 

 

After the Windows 8 Update

  • "There was problem connecting to the printer. Make sure it is connected and try again."

Observed when attempting to print from a New Windows 8 style application.

  • "Test page failed to print. Would you like to view the print troubleshooter for assistance?"


Observed when attempting to print a test page from Printer Properties.

Print Troubleshooter Note: Do not say Yes, as it will not resolve your problem.  

 

Suggested Remedy 

 

 

To regain the ability to print:

  1. Open your Desktop.
  2. Open Control Panel.
  3. Open (View) Devices and Printers under Hardware and Sound.
  4. Locate your printer object.
  5. Right-click on the Lexmark Printer Object and choose “Remove Device”.
  6. Uninstall the Lexmark Series Printer from either the Lexmark Uninstaller or Control Panel > Programs (Programs and Features) > Uninstall a program. 
  7. Reinstall the Lexmark Series Printer using the Lexmark installer software. NOTE: Driver should be Windows 7 driver or newer.
  8. Click OK or Apply.
  9. After the reinstall of the printer, open the Printer Properties > Ports tab and check the “Enable Bidirectional Support” checkbox. Click here for image.
  10. Restart the PC.
  11. Return to your Windows 8 app and try to reinitiate your print job.
